Raising Little Turkeys : The Complete Guide
Successfully caring for young turkeys, often called babies, can be rewarding , but necessitates dedication and precise attention to their requirements . Initially , providing a draft-free brooder space is crucial , maintaining a heat of around 95°F (35°C) for the early week, gradually decreasing it by 5 degrees each seven days thereafter. Adequate nutrition is equally necessary, with crumbled turkey food offered continuously in shallow feeders . Fresh water must always be present, and safety from threats like rodents and chickens is entirely essential for their longevity.

Distinguishing Your Bird – Tom vs. Female Features
Determining if you’re observing a male or a hen turkey can be relatively straightforward with a little attention to detail. Males generally show significantly bigger size and vibrant feathers, often including a striking iridescent bronze sheen on their head . They also possess a substantial beard, a extended cluster of altered feathers on their front. Hens , on the contrary hand, are typically smaller in size, with less bright brown covering and aren’t equipped with a beard altogether. In addition, listen for the unique gobbling sound, which is mainly made by the males .
